Second Graders to Host Special Veterans Day Musical
Dexter, Missouri - Second grade students at Southwest Elementary School in Dexter have been rehearsing for a very special performance.

The students, under the direction of James Eldreth, will host a public performance on Thursday, November 12th, the day after Veterans Day to honor all veterans for their military service.

The public, area veterans, families and friends are encouraged to attend the event beginning at 7:00 p.m. at Southwest Elementary School.

The presentation will be approximately 30 minutes.  During the performance, each branch of the military will be recognized and Taps will be played.
